What affects the price

When you look at MCA financing, the cost isn't one-size-fits-all. Lenders weigh a few key things when determining your rate. First, they check your consistent monthly revenue—the higher your sales, the better your positioning. They also look at your business history and how long you have been operating. Your industry matters too, as some sectors carry more risk than others. Additionally, your repayment timeframe plays a major role; a shorter term might reduce your overall expense, while longer terms spread payments out differently. We keep it straightforward so you can decide what fits your cash flow. Typically, rates range from 1.1 to 1.5 in factor fees.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What is a merchant cash advance?

A merchant cash advance (MCA) provides a business with a lump sum of cash in exchange for a portion of its future credit and debit card sales. For businesses in Richmond, this can be a faster alternative to conventional bank loans for working capital. Repayments are typically made through automatic deductions from daily sales, offering flexibility.
